+//| .. currentmodule:: audiomp3
+//|
+//| :class:`MP3Decoder` -- Load a mp3 file for audio playback
+//| =========================================================
+//|
+//| An object that decodes MP3 files for playback on an audio device.
+//|
+//| .. class:: MP3(file[, buffer])
+//|
+//| Load a .mp3 file for playback with `audioio.AudioOut` or `audiobusio.I2SOut`.
+//|
+//| :param typing.BinaryIO file: Already opened mp3 file
+//| :param bytearray buffer: Optional pre-allocated buffer, that will be split in half and used for double-buffering of the data. If not provided, two buffers are allocated internally. The specific buffer size required depends on the mp3 file.
+//|
+//|
+//| Playing a mp3 file from flash::
+//|
+//| import board
+//| import audiomp3
+//| import audioio
+//| import digitalio
+//|
+//| # Required for CircuitPlayground Express
+//| speaker_enable = digitalio.DigitalInOut(board.SPEAKER_ENABLE)
+//| speaker_enable.switch_to_output(value=True)
+//|
+//| data = open("cplay-16bit-16khz-64kbps.mp3", "rb")
+//| mp3 = audiomp3.MP3Decoder(data)
+//| a = audioio.AudioOut(board.A0)
+//|
+//| print("playing")
+//| a.play(mp3)
+//| while a.playing:
+//| pass
+//| print("stopped")
+//|
+STATIC mp_obj_t audiomp3_mp3file_make_new(const mp_obj_type_t *type, size_t n_args, const mp_obj_t *args, mp_map_t *kw_args) {
+ mp_arg_check_num(n_args, kw_args, 1, 2, false);
+
+ audiomp3_mp3file_obj_t *self = m_new_obj(audiomp3_mp3file_obj_t);
+ self->base.type = &audiomp3_mp3file_type;
+ if (!MP_OBJ_IS_TYPE(args[0], &mp_type_fileio)) {
+ mp_raise_TypeError(translate("file must be a file opened in byte mode"));
+ }
+ uint8_t *buffer = NULL;
+ size_t buffer_size = 0;
+ if (n_args >= 2) {
+ mp_buffer_info_t bufinfo;
+ mp_get_buffer_raise(args[1], &bufinfo, MP_BUFFER_WRITE);
+ buffer = bufinfo.buf;
+ buffer_size = bufinfo.len;
+ }
+ common_hal_audiomp3_mp3file_construct(self, MP_OBJ_TO_PTR(args[0]),
+ buffer, buffer_size);
+
+ return MP_OBJ_FROM_PTR(self);
+}
+
+//| .. method:: deinit()
+//|
+//| Deinitialises the MP3 and releases all memory resources for reuse.
+//|
+STATIC mp_obj_t audiomp3_mp3file_deinit(mp_obj_t self_in) {
+ audiomp3_mp3file_obj_t *self = MP_OBJ_TO_PTR(self_in);
+ common_hal_audiomp3_mp3file_deinit(self);
+ return mp_const_none;
+}
+STATIC MP_DEFINE_CONST_FUN_OBJ_1(audiomp3_mp3file_deinit_obj, audiomp3_mp3file_deinit);
+
+STATIC void check_for_deinit(audiomp3_mp3file_obj_t *self) {
+ if (common_hal_audiomp3_mp3file_deinited(self)) {
+ raise_deinited_error();
+ }
+}
+
+//| .. method:: __enter__()
+//|
+//| No-op used by Context Managers.
+//|
+// Provided by context manager helper.
+
+//| .. method:: __exit__()
+//|
+//| Automatically deinitializes the hardware when exiting a context. See
+//| :ref:`lifetime-and-contextmanagers` for more info.
+//|
+STATIC mp_obj_t audiomp3_mp3file_obj___exit__(size_t n_args, const mp_obj_t *args) {
+ (void)n_args;
+ common_hal_audiomp3_mp3file_deinit(args[0]);
+ return mp_const_none;
+}
+STATIC MP_DEFINE_CONST_FUN_OBJ_VAR_BETWEEN(audiomp3_mp3file___exit___obj, 4, 4, audiomp3_mp3file_obj___exit__);
+
+//| .. attribute:: file
+//|
+//| File to play back.
+//|
+STATIC mp_obj_t audiomp3_mp3file_obj_get_file(mp_obj_t self_in) {
+ audiomp3_mp3file_obj_t *self = MP_OBJ_TO_PTR(self_in);
+ check_for_deinit(self);
+ return self->file;
+}
+MP_DEFINE_CONST_FUN_OBJ_1(audiomp3_mp3file_get_file_obj, audiomp3_mp3file_obj_get_file);
+
+STATIC mp_obj_t audiomp3_mp3file_obj_set_file(mp_obj_t self_in, mp_obj_t file) {
+ audiomp3_mp3file_obj_t *self = MP_OBJ_TO_PTR(self_in);
+ check_for_deinit(self);
+ if (!MP_OBJ_IS_TYPE(file, &mp_type_fileio)) {
+ mp_raise_TypeError(translate("file must be a file opened in byte mode"));
+ }
+ common_hal_audiomp3_mp3file_set_file(self, file);
+ return mp_const_none;
+}
+MP_DEFINE_CONST_FUN_OBJ_2(audiomp3_mp3file_set_file_obj, audiomp3_mp3file_obj_set_file);
+
+const mp_obj_property_t audiomp3_mp3file_file_obj = {
+ .base.type = &mp_type_property,
+ .proxy = {(mp_obj_t)&audiomp3_mp3file_get_file_obj,
+ (mp_obj_t)&audiomp3_mp3file_set_file_obj,
+ (mp_obj_t)&mp_const_none_obj},
+};
+
+
+
+//| .. attribute:: sample_rate
+//|
+//| 32 bit value that dictates how quickly samples are loaded into the DAC
+//| in Hertz (cycles per second). When the sample is looped, this can change
+//| the pitch output without changing the underlying sample.
+//|
+STATIC mp_obj_t audiomp3_mp3file_obj_get_sample_rate(mp_obj_t self_in) {
+ audiomp3_mp3file_obj_t *self = MP_OBJ_TO_PTR(self_in);
+ check_for_deinit(self);
+ return MP_OBJ_NEW_SMALL_INT(common_hal_audiomp3_mp3file_get_sample_rate(self));
+}
+MP_DEFINE_CONST_FUN_OBJ_1(audiomp3_mp3file_get_sample_rate_obj, audiomp3_mp3file_obj_get_sample_rate);
+
+STATIC mp_obj_t audiomp3_mp3file_obj_set_sample_rate(mp_obj_t self_in, mp_obj_t sample_rate) {
+ audiomp3_mp3file_obj_t *self = MP_OBJ_TO_PTR(self_in);
+ check_for_deinit(self);
+ common_hal_audiomp3_mp3file_set_sample_rate(self, mp_obj_get_int(sample_rate));
+ return mp_const_none;
+}
+MP_DEFINE_CONST_FUN_OBJ_2(audiomp3_mp3file_set_sample_rate_obj, audiomp3_mp3file_obj_set_sample_rate);
+
+const mp_obj_property_t audiomp3_mp3file_sample_rate_obj = {
+ .base.type = &mp_type_property,
+ .proxy = {(mp_obj_t)&audiomp3_mp3file_get_sample_rate_obj,
+ (mp_obj_t)&audiomp3_mp3file_set_sample_rate_obj,
+ (mp_obj_t)&mp_const_none_obj},
+};
+
+//| .. attribute:: bits_per_sample
+//|
+//| Bits per sample. (read only)
+//|
+STATIC mp_obj_t audiomp3_mp3file_obj_get_bits_per_sample(mp_obj_t self_in) {
+ audiomp3_mp3file_obj_t *self = MP_OBJ_TO_PTR(self_in);
+ check_for_deinit(self);
+ return MP_OBJ_NEW_SMALL_INT(common_hal_audiomp3_mp3file_get_bits_per_sample(self));
+}
+MP_DEFINE_CONST_FUN_OBJ_1(audiomp3_mp3file_get_bits_per_sample_obj, audiomp3_mp3file_obj_get_bits_per_sample);
+
+const mp_obj_property_t audiomp3_mp3file_bits_per_sample_obj = {
+ .base.type = &mp_type_property,
+ .proxy = {(mp_obj_t)&audiomp3_mp3file_get_bits_per_sample_obj,
+ (mp_obj_t)&mp_const_none_obj,
+ (mp_obj_t)&mp_const_none_obj},
+};
+
+//| .. attribute:: channel_count
+//|
+//| Number of audio channels. (read only)
+//|
+STATIC mp_obj_t audiomp3_mp3file_obj_get_channel_count(mp_obj_t self_in) {
+ audiomp3_mp3file_obj_t *self = MP_OBJ_TO_PTR(self_in);
+ check_for_deinit(self);
+ return MP_OBJ_NEW_SMALL_INT(common_hal_audiomp3_mp3file_get_channel_count(self));
+}
+MP_DEFINE_CONST_FUN_OBJ_1(audiomp3_mp3file_get_channel_count_obj, audiomp3_mp3file_obj_get_channel_count);
+
+const mp_obj_property_t audiomp3_mp3file_channel_count_obj = {
+ .base.type = &mp_type_property,
+ .proxy = {(mp_obj_t)&audiomp3_mp3file_get_channel_count_obj,
+ (mp_obj_t)&mp_const_none_obj,
+ (mp_obj_t)&mp_const_none_obj},
+};
+
+//| .. attribute:: rms_level
+//|
+//| The RMS audio level of a recently played moment of audio. (read only)
+//|
+STATIC mp_obj_t audiomp3_mp3file_obj_get_rms_level(mp_obj_t self_in) {
+ audiomp3_mp3file_obj_t *self = MP_OBJ_TO_PTR(self_in);
+ check_for_deinit(self);
+ return mp_obj_new_float(common_hal_audiomp3_mp3file_get_rms_level(self));
+}
+MP_DEFINE_CONST_FUN_OBJ_1(audiomp3_mp3file_get_rms_level_obj, audiomp3_mp3file_obj_get_rms_level);
+
+const mp_obj_property_t audiomp3_mp3file_rms_level_obj = {
+ .base.type = &mp_type_property,
+ .proxy = {(mp_obj_t)&audiomp3_mp3file_get_rms_level_obj,
+ (mp_obj_t)&mp_const_none_obj,
+ (mp_obj_t)&mp_const_none_obj},
+};
+
+
+STATIC const mp_rom_map_elem_t audiomp3_mp3file_locals_dict_table[] = {
+ // Methods
+ { MP_ROM_QSTR(MP_QSTR_deinit), MP_ROM_PTR(&audiomp3_mp3file_deinit_obj) },
+ { MP_ROM_QSTR(MP_QSTR___enter__), MP_ROM_PTR(&default___enter___obj) },
+ { MP_ROM_QSTR(MP_QSTR___exit__), MP_ROM_PTR(&audiomp3_mp3file___exit___obj) },
+
+ // Properties
+ { MP_ROM_QSTR(MP_QSTR_file), MP_ROM_PTR(&audiomp3_mp3file_file_obj) },
+ { MP_ROM_QSTR(MP_QSTR_sample_rate), MP_ROM_PTR(&audiomp3_mp3file_sample_rate_obj) },
+ { MP_ROM_QSTR(MP_QSTR_bits_per_sample), MP_ROM_PTR(&audiomp3_mp3file_bits_per_sample_obj) },
+ { MP_ROM_QSTR(MP_QSTR_channel_count), MP_ROM_PTR(&audiomp3_mp3file_channel_count_obj) },
+ { MP_ROM_QSTR(MP_QSTR_rms_level), MP_ROM_PTR(&audiomp3_mp3file_rms_level_obj) },
+};
+STATIC MP_DEFINE_CONST_DICT(audiomp3_mp3file_locals_dict, audiomp3_mp3file_locals_dict_table);
+
+STATIC const audiosample_p_t audiomp3_mp3file_proto = {
+ MP_PROTO_IMPLEMENT(MP_QSTR_protocol_audiosample)
+ .sample_rate = (audiosample_sample_rate_fun)common_hal_audiomp3_mp3file_get_sample_rate,
+ .bits_per_sample = (audiosample_bits_per_sample_fun)common_hal_audiomp3_mp3file_get_bits_per_sample,
+ .channel_count = (audiosample_channel_count_fun)common_hal_audiomp3_mp3file_get_channel_count,
+ .reset_buffer = (audiosample_reset_buffer_fun)audiomp3_mp3file_reset_buffer,
+ .get_buffer = (audiosample_get_buffer_fun)audiomp3_mp3file_get_buffer,
+ .get_buffer_structure = (audiosample_get_buffer_structure_fun)audiomp3_mp3file_get_buffer_structure,
+};
+
+const mp_obj_type_t audiomp3_mp3file_type = {
+ { &mp_type_type },
+ .name = MP_QSTR_MP3Decoder,
+ .make_new = audiomp3_mp3file_make_new,
+ .locals_dict = (mp_obj_dict_t*)&audiomp3_mp3file_locals_dict,
+ .protocol = &audiomp3_mp3file_proto,
+};
